Nectar's AI Assistant: A Game Changer in Operational Intelligence
Nectar Services Corp., a prominent player in the realm of unified communications, has made a significant stride forward with the launch of its native AI Assistant. This innovative tool is designed to convert extensive operational telemetry into readily accessible operational intelligence, fundamentally altering how organizations interact with their data. Through this assistant, operators can communicate with Nectar's telemetry and service data via natural language, eliminating the need for separate AI tools or external data manipulation.
The introduction of the AI Assistant marks a pivotal shift in operational analytics. Previously, traditional observability tools were restricted by predefined views and rigid dashboards. With Nectar's latest offering, users can now engage with their data more intuitively. Whether it’s understanding session data, examining call analytics, or exploring multi-vendor environments, operators can ask the specific questions they need and receive detailed responses instantaneously. This evolution allows teams to pinpoint anomalies, derive insightful metrics, and obtain informed remediation guidance faster than ever.
Key Features of the AI Assistant
The AI Assistant comes equipped with a range of powerful capabilities designed to enhance operational efficiency:
- - Natural Language Querying: Users can perform dynamic queries on extensive datasets encompassing voice, video, chat, and more.
- - Early Detection of Issues: The assistant provides proactive alerts on service degradation and customer experience challenges, allowing issues to be addressed before they escalate.
- - Context-Aware Analysis: Users can benefit from integrated historical and real-time data that supports accurate root cause analysis.
- - Remediation Guidance: AI-generated suggestions facilitate decision-making related to configurations, capacities, or necessary escalations.
- - Dynamic Reporting: Users can create and save custom reports and dashboards, reflecting their specific needs and insights.
Built for Seamless Integration
What sets Nectar apart is its commitment to an AI-ready framework from the outset. Unlike many platforms that retrofit AI into existing structures, Nectar’s architecture was designed with API accessibility at its core. The AI Assistant operates seamlessly, utilizing consistent access controls and permissions to ensure security throughout AI interactions. Such design not only streamlines operations but also upholds the highest standards of data governance.
By integrating functionalities that are unified across both internal and external assistance, Nectar avoids the pitfalls of managing separate proprietary tools, thereby reducing technical debt and enhancing innovation.
